Nvidia 3D Vision 2 Wireless Glasses (Extra Pair) Review
The good: The Nvidia 3D Vision 2 glasses have a snug, comfy fit, hold a long charge, and sport the best 3D performance on any PC.
The bad: There's still noticeable crosstalk during games and the $85 price is asking a lot.
The bottom line: Thanks to its bright images and minimal crosstalk, the Nvidia 3D Vision 2 glasses with Lightboost are the current best 3D solution for gaming and watching movies on the PC.
